Hopes and Dreams

The years teach much what the days never knew, When dainty dreams and heavenly hope across the skies flew. One by one a few of them began to go away, Some changed directions, some fell back, a few others gone astray. But some were strong though tiny they were, they had a certain knack, Looked left and right along the track but never looking back. Hopes and dreams are sugar-coated bitter verses of life, When they help you u're in mirth, or they're sharper than a knife.
